Angelina Jolie appealed to the international community to send more aid to Pakistan as she toured the flood-ravaged country today.
The Hollywood star spoke to people displaced by the heavy flooding as she arrived in Pakistan as part of a two day visit in her role as a goodwill ambassador for the United Nations' refugee agency.
The actress, 35, said she had been 'very moved' by the stories she had heard and the devastation she had witnessed.
